- 摘要:
- 节约和替代燃料油是解决我国石油资源短缺,缓解石油供需矛盾,增强企业竞争力的措施之一。在油气集输领域,以煤作燃料代替燃料油可以有效地降低生产成本,节约油气资源,实现企业节能降耗的目的。文章较详细地介绍了一种燃煤分体相变加热装置的工作原理、结构特点、性能特点,从它的结构特点和性能特点上看,该装置在油气集输领域作为加热装置是可行的,且能缓解上述矛盾。
Fuel saving and fuel replacement are the fundamental strategic measures to solve the problems of petroleum resource shortage, to mitigate contradictions of petroleum supply and demand, as well as to ensure country′s economic safety. In oil and gas gathering and transporting area, the replacement of oil with coal can reduce production cost significantly, save oil and gas resources and reach the target of saving energy and cutting down consumption. In this paper, the operational principle, structural feature and functional characteristic of heating device of fuel coal disintegration phase transformation are illustrated in detail.
